Gophers Earn 20th Win with 83-60 Victory Over Wisconsin

2/15/2026 7:09:00 PM | Women's Basketball

It marks the third consecutive season that head coach Dawn Plitzuweit has achieved 20 wins

MADISON, Wis. - Mara Braun scored 20 points to help lead the Minnesota women's basketball team (20-6, 11-4 Big Ten) past the Wisconsin Badgers (13-13, 5-10 Big Ten) 83-60 on the road Sunday.

The Golden Gophers had four players score in double figures, led by Braun, who had 20 points. Amaya Battle tacked on 17 points and Sophie Hart helped out with 13 points and six rebounds. Tori McKinney had 12 points and matched her career high with five steals.

Minnesota out-rebounded Wisconsin 29-26 in Sunday's game, paced by six boards from Hart. The Gophers also grabbed 10 offensive rebounds and scored 17 second chance points.

The Minnesota defense was effective at taking away the basketball in Sunday's game, forcing 21 Wisconsin turnovers while committing 12. Those takeaways turned into 26 points on the other end of the floor. McKinney's five steals led the way individually for the Maroon and Gold.

How It Happened

Minnesota struggled out of the gate, falling behind 18-12 at the end of the first quarter.

Minnesota kept the Badgers from increasing their lead before going on a 7-0 run, highlighted by a three from Braun, to take a 21-20 lead. The Gophers proceeded to tack on eight points to that lead and enjoyed a 40-31 advantage heading into halftime. Minnesota dominated in the paint, scoring 14 of its 28 points close to the basket.

Minnesota continued to preserve its halftime lead before going on a 7-0 run to expand its lead further to 54-40 with 5:06 to go in the third. Before the conclusion of the third period, the Badgers had cut into that lead somewhat, but the Gophers still entered the fourth quarter with a 62-50 edge. Minnesota knocked down three three-pointers in the quarter to score nine of its 22 total points.

Minnesota started tacking on points in the fourth almost immediately, going on a 6-0 run, finished off by Hart's layup, to grow the lead to 68-50 with 8:19 to go in the contest. The Gophers kept expanding the margin and coasted the rest of the way for the 83-60 win. Minnesota took advantage of its opportunities in the post, scoring 14 of its 21 points in the paint.
